Hi all, I'm trying to set two virtual routers in HA with CloudStack 4.2 and KVM. I created a new Network offering (same as the default one). However, I cannot see any new virtual routers after enabling the network offering. As a result I want to get two (or more) routers that serve my network in parallel.
Can you give me any clues what I may be missing? Thank you! Krasimir Baylov On Tue, Nov 5, 2013 at 12:22 PM, Geoff Higginbottom < geoff.higginbot...@shapeblue.com> wrote: > Jerry, > > CloudStack will try and keep the two Virtual Routers separate, running on > different Hosts/Clusters/PODs to help with HA, as long as there are > suitable resources available. > > When using the Redundant Router feature, the two VRs run in an > Active/Passive mode, and both are also treated as HA.
